From acb13f12b2a8ad5ca948ac0e7d7a5dc9d6ace130 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Gregor=20Jer=C5=A1e?= Date: Wed, 8 Nov 2023 14:33:42 +0100 Subject: [PATCH] Fix tests failing due to random ordering of ids --- resolwe/flow/tests/test_api.py | 5 ++--- resolwe/permissions/tests/test_data.py | 4 +--- 2 files changed, 3 insertions(+), 6 deletions(-) diff --git a/resolwe/flow/tests/test_api.py b/resolwe/flow/tests/test_api.py index 07493ded4..747ca7761 100644 --- a/resolwe/flow/tests/test_api.py +++ b/resolwe/flow/tests/test_api.py @@ -1780,9 +1780,8 @@ def test_bulk_delete(self): request_path, data={"ids": [entity1.pk, entity2.pk]}, format="json" ) self.assertEqual(response.status_code, status.HTTP_403_FORBIDDEN) - self.assertEqual( - response.data["detail"], - f"No permission to delete objects with ids {entity1.pk}, {entity2.pk}.", + self.assertIn( + "No permission to delete objects with ids", response.data["detail"] ) self.assertTrue(Entity.objects.filter(pk=entity1.pk).exists()) self.assertTrue(Entity.objects.filter(pk=entity2.pk).exists()) diff --git a/resolwe/permissions/tests/test_data.py b/resolwe/permissions/tests/test_data.py index b2002a152..572606de7 100644 --- a/resolwe/permissions/tests/test_data.py +++ b/resolwe/permissions/tests/test_data.py @@ -666,9 +666,7 @@ def test_bulk_delete(self): # No permission. response = self.client.post(request_path, data={"ids": [1, 2]}, format="json") self.assertEqual(response.status_code, status.HTTP_403_FORBIDDEN) - self.assertEqual( - response.data["detail"], "No permission to delete objects with ids 1, 2." - ) + self.assertIn("No permission to delete objects", response.data["detail"]) self.assertTrue(Data.objects.filter(pk=1).exists()) self.assertTrue(Data.objects.filter(pk=2).exists())